Actions supported by the connector

Trigger Nango Action
Run a configured action against a connected integration.
Add Connection
Register a new integration connection.
List Connections
Retrieve the list of active integration connections.
Trigger Sync
Start a data sync for a connected integration.
Get Sync Status
Check the status of a running data sync.
